China offshore oil and gas exploration: review and thinking
Zhu Weilin
Strategic Study of CAE 2011, Volume 13, Issue 5, Pages 4-9
This paper introduces the recent years' achievements made in China offshore exploration and summarizes the successful procedures and experiences, and analyzes the road to sustainable development for China offshore exploration.
